Logan, who happens to be the eldest child of Kody and Janelle Brown, has chosen to lead a life outside the spotlight of the TLC show “Sister Wives.” Thus, much of the information about him and Michelle comes from Janelle, who takes immense pride in her son’s life choices. Interestingly, Logan and Michelle’s marriage hinted at underlying tensions within the Brown family, as photographs revealed a significant physical distance between Kody, Janelle, and Robyn during the wedding ceremony.

Michelle Brown has long been perceived as a person with a kind and generous heart. This became evident even before her marriage to Logan when she selflessly donated a kidney to a complete stranger in 2020. It seems that extending their family to include rescue pups is a natural extension of her compassionate nature. Recently, they adopted a girl dog named Kirby, providing her with a loving home.

The heartwarming news of Kirby’s arrival in the Petty Brown household first broke on Facebook and eventually made its way to Reddit. Kirby, a delightful mix of Labrador, Shiba Inu, and Jindo breeds, hails from a dog meat farm in Korea. Remarkably, Logan and Michelle had met Kirby at a rescue center before Athena’s passing, leading to their decision to give her a forever home. Kirby’s sibling now resides with Hunter Brown and his girlfriend, Audrey.

Logan and Michelle’s immediate response to Kirby’s urgent need for a home exemplifies their dedication to making a difference in the lives of animals in need.
